Is insurance available in New York?

We offer our $1M coverage in all states, but there are some limitations to how this coverage works in New York due to its unique regulatory environment. While we’re working on expanding our offerings there, here’s a look at the current state of NY insurance.

Towables/Trailers

If your rig is registered in NY, our standard coverages are available to your renters, along with the convenient delivery coverage option. You can find out more about your protection here.

Motorized RVs

If your RV is registered in NY, we are unable to offer our insurance if your renter plans on traveling in the RV or moving the vehicle. However, we’re pleased to offer delivery coverage. This means you’re covered during the delivery and pickup of your vehicle, and your rig is covered during the rental while it remains stationary.

Additional FAQs

If a renter books my RV in another state but drives through New York, how does the insurance work? 

As long as the vehicle isn’t registered in New York and insurance is approved on the booking, renters can drive through the state with no issues.

Why does coverage work differently in NY? 

The NY Department of Financial Services does not currently support motorized insurance for several marketplace businesses, including Outdoorsy.

Along with our insurance partners and like-minded business ventures, we are continuing to investigate ways to insure your RV while renting within the state. However, until the regulatory environment changes, this means we are limited in our insurance offerings.
